Output 149059bb8c5212775e5a4e02b960ad72024dfa7b1f8cae7a4180400244160066:1

value
51320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 291d6fdfce8bc8b5bee72a5665ffc464314d2bc8 OP_EQUAL
address
9vBfdaFEazXcBqULwFNWNTdNkKY1yuAqjt
transaction
149059bb8c5212775e5a4e02b960ad72024dfa7b1f8cae7a4180400244160066